Hematuria is blood in the urine. When the urine is red or pink this could be linked to blood in the urine and is called “gross” or “visible” hematuria. Sometimes, blood is in the urine but is not easily seen and it is called “microscopic” hematuria since it can only be seen under a microscope.

Webas the PPV of any haematuria was 0.99 for men <45 years and 0.22 for women < 45 years, 2WW referral is recommended only for people with visible haematuria age >45 without a UTI, or persisting/recurring despite treatment of a UTI.
